Project Task Manager information

How does a project task man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during a project?

A Project Task Manager works closely with various departments such as engineering, marketing, and finance to ensure tasks are aligned with overall project goals. They facilitate regular meetings, coordinate task assignments, and communicate updates or obstacles to stakeholders. This role often acts as a bridge between team members, resolving conflicts, clarifying expectations, and ensuring everyone stays on track. Effective collaboration is essential for timely project completion and successful out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project task man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Task Manager, you need strong organizational abilities, experience in project planning, and a background in project management—often supported by a deg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with project management software like Asana, Trello, or Microsoft Project, as well as certifications such as PMP or CAPM, is typically required.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ills help you coordinate teams and adapt to shifting project needs. These skills ensure efficient task execution, timely project delivery, and successful collaboration across stakeholders.

What is a project task manager?

Project Task Managers are professionals responsible for organizing, coordinating, and overseeing specific tasks within a project to ensure they are completed on time and within scope. They work closely with team members to assign duties, track progress, and manage resources. Their role is crucial for maintaining project schedules, addressing obstacles, and communicating updates to stakeholders. By focusing on task-level management, they help ensure the overall success of larger projects.

What is the difference between Project Task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ectProject Task ManagerProject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ees specific project tasks, manages task assignments, tracks progress, ensures deadlines are metSupports project activities, coordinates communication, assists with scheduling and documentation
Required SkillsTask management, time management, basic project planning, communicationCommunication, organization, scheduling, administrative skills
CertificationsOften PMP or CAPM, relevant project management certificationsLess formal certifications, often related to administration or coordination
Work EnvironmentTypically in project teams, on-site or remote, within various industriesOffice-based, supporting project teams across industries

While both roles support project execution, the Project Task Manager focuses on managing specific tasks and ensuring timely completion, whereas the Project Coordinator provides administrative support and facilitates communication within the project team.

Job description

The Digital Modernization Sector project/area at Leidos has an opening for an experienced Project Manager for the DISA Defense Red Switch Network in support of an enterprise VoIP management system GSM-O II contract at Fort Meade, MD.
The Project Manager is responsible for working within a fast-paced project team to deliver high quality products efficiently and effectively. This position requires someone who thrives in a fast-paced, dynamic environment and can work collaboratively with cross-functional teams. The ideal candidate will be responsible for supporting the planning, execution, and monitoring of projects to ensure they are completed on time, within scope, and on budget. This position requires strong communication and problem-solving skills, along with the ability to work collaboratively with various stakeholders to drive project success.
Must hold an active Top Secret with SCI Eligibility to be hired. No sponsorships for this position.
Primary Responsibilities
  • Manage multiple concurrent tasks and projects to support the planning and implementation of the Defense Red Switch Network (DRSN)
  • Work independently, engage with required stakeholders, and execute an end-to-end plan to achieve operational efficiencies within the project area of responsibility
  • Work closely with technical resources to develop an approach, schedule, risks, and staffing requirements to successfully implement the objectives
  • Communicate with internal team members across multiple areas, external stakeholders, and the DISA customers
  • Analyze external activities that may drive dependencies or risks to the plan(s).
  • Understand all applicable performance standards, operational impacts, and affected Acceptable Levels of Performance that may be impacted by the change
  • Support process improvements, including identifying inefficiencies and recommending solutions to streamline project execution
  • Provide overall support for customer meetings, including initial input for charts, action- item tracking, and general data calls
  • Understanding of DISA implementation process and standard.
  • Understanding of Site Assessment, Site Survey, Installation, and Commissioning equipment
  • Ability to interact/communicate with customers
  • Develop and maintain project schedules, tracking progress, and identifying external dependencies, risks, or delays
  • Prepare project documentation, including CDRLs, ROMB, COR/PMR/MOR Charts, 5x15, presentations, reports, and meeting minutes and actions
  • Assist/Monitor project tasks are completed in compliance with Leidos and customer policies, quality standards, and regulatory requirements
  • Coordinate and transfer inputs for project reviews (e.g., MOR, QBRs, etc.) and actions item tracking/coordination
  • Coach, review, and delegate work to junior project staff and support personnel to ensure quality and timely delivery
